Don't Fall for Phishing Scams!

Phishing scams are on the rise, and it's easier than ever to be caught. These devious attempts aim for your account credentials by posing as well-known companies. Don't become a victim to these scams!

  • Watch out for unsolicited emails asking for sensitive information.
  • Confirm the legitimacy before clicking any links.
  • Create complex passwords and enable two-factor authentication for added security.

Stay informed about the latest fraudulent methods. Report any suspected attacks to the appropriate agencies.

Online Scams: Recognize and Report

Be aware of possible online scams. Con artists are constantly creating new ways to deceive innocent people. Always verify information from unfamiliar sources. Be wary about sharing private information online, and never reply to unsolicited requests . If you suspect you've been defrauded, report it to the relevant authorities immediately.

  • {Report scams to your local police department, the Federal Trade Commission (FTC), or the Internet Crime Complaint Center (IC3).
  • {Protect your online accounts by using strong passwords and multi-factor authentication.
  • Educate yourself and others about common online scams. Spread awareness to help prevent falling victim.
